This odd mural is located on the side of the Steak ‘n Egg Kitchen located on Wisconsin Ave just north of Tenleytown. What’s even more bizarre is that it is located right next to a big Obama mural?

IMG_2711

The “I don’t speak English” seems to be a part of the original work and not just graffiti. Or do you think it is graffiti? What am I missing here? This is bizarre, right?
